Output 52c3270c031a2f4b1f683f9c60ae7bd75ff003185c8b08600ecc58391e5f0fa5:20

value
272124734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99761888e53213ebdf135fd2d52aa9b5780505ee OP_EQUAL
address
3FgSnLUPCiYvHfebNkxopovDA1GLZ7Mogz
transaction
52c3270c031a2f4b1f683f9c60ae7bd75ff003185c8b08600ecc58391e5f0fa5
spent
true